Bugün Denemeniz Gereken En İyi 6 Raspberry Pi IoT Projesi [2022]

Yayınlanan: 2021-01-09

Raspberry Pi, yönlendiriciden oyun konsoluna kadar her şey olarak kullanabileceğiniz küçük bir bilgisayardır. Çok yönlülüğü, bu makalede tartıştığımız IoT projeleri için mükemmel olmasını sağlar.

Raspberry Pi, otonom bir sulama sistemi ve yüz tanıma robotu oluşturmanıza yardımcı olabilir. Onu Nesnelerin İnterneti ile birleştiriyoruz ve ikisinin nasıl harika projelere yol açabileceğini keşfediyoruz.

IoT olarak da bilinen Nesnelerin İnterneti, son zamanların en güçlü teknolojilerinden biridir. Daha önce internet üzerinden kullanamadığınız aletleri ve araçları kontrol etmek için interneti kullanmanızı sağlar. Özerk sistemler ve akıllı anahtarlar, gerçek hayatta IoT uygulamalarının harika örnekleridir.

Kariyerinizi hızlandırmak için Dünyanın en iyi Üniversiteleri - Yüksek Lisanslar, Yönetici Yüksek Lisans Programları ve Makine Öğrenimi ve Yapay Zeka alanında İleri Düzey Sertifika Programından çevrimiçi olarak ML Kursuna katılın .

IoT tabanlı çözümler geliştirmekle ilgileniyorsanız, doğru yerdesiniz. Burada, en heyecan verici Raspberry Pi IoT projelerinden bazılarını tartışıyoruz. Listemiz, ilgi alanlarınıza ve uzmanlığınıza göre birini seçebilmeniz için çeşitli beceri düzeyleri ve sektörlerden projeler içerir.

İçindekiler

En İyi Raspberry Pi IoT Projeleri

1. Kalabalık Boyutlarını Tahmin Edin ve Virüsle Mücadele Edin

Mevcut salgın dünyamızı tamamen değiştirdi. Farklı teknolojileri ve alışkanlıkları yaşam tarzımıza dahil ederek bu yeni değişimlere uyum sağlıyoruz. Bu salgınla savaşmak için bir çözüm oluşturmak istiyorsanız, bu proje üzerinde çalışabilirsiniz.

Bu projede, kalabalık boyutlarını tahmin edebilen bir Raspberry Pi çözümü oluşturacaksınız. Sosyal mesafenin ne kadar önemli olduğunu hepimiz biliyoruz. Belirli bir yerdeki kalabalığın boyutunu belirleyerek, insanların sosyal mesafeye uygun olup olmadığını anlayabilirsiniz. Daha sonra bu teknolojiyi halka açık yerlerde kullanabilir ve yetkililere sosyal mesafe kurallarını daha etkili bir şekilde uygulama konusunda yardımcı olabilirsiniz.

Kalabalık boyutlarını tahmin etmek için sisteminiz nesne algılama gerçekleştirmelidir. Nesne algılama, sisteminizin bir görüntü içinde bulunan belirli nesneleri tanıyabileceği bir Yapay Zeka kavramıdır. Raspberry Pi dışında bir Pi Camera, Python ve OpenCV'ye de ihtiyacınız olacak. Bu projeyi tamamladıktan sonra, nesne algılama ve yapay zekanın gerçek hayattaki uygulamalarına aşina olacaksınız. Ayrıca, salgınla savaşmak için teknolojiyi nasıl kullanabileceğinizi de bileceksiniz. Temel bilgilere zaten aşinaysanız, ona daha fazla işlevsellik ekleyerek daha zor hale getirebilirsiniz.

2. IoT'ye Dayalı Akıllı Enerji Monitörü

Enerji monitörleri, belirli bir cihazın (veya cihazların) ne kadar enerji tükettiğini gösteren cihazlardır. Bu bilgilerle enerji tüketiminizi kontrol altında tutabilir ve gerekirse ayarlamalar yapabilirsiniz. Bir enerji monitörü, enerji israfını azaltmanıza ve çevreyi korumanıza yardımcı olabilir.

Dolayısıyla, çevre için çözümler oluşturmak için teknik becerilerinizi kullanmak istediyseniz, bu sizin için harika bir projedir. Bu proje üzerinde çalışmaya başlamadan önce, tehlikeli olan bir AC kaynağı ile çalışmanız gerektiğini bilmelisiniz. Bu nedenle, bu görev üzerinde çalışmaya başlamadan önce tüm güvenlik önlemlerini izleyin.

Burada Raspberry Pi tabanlı akıllı bir enerji monitörü oluşturacaksınız. Enerji monitörünüz aşağıdaki bileşenlere sahip olacaktır:

  • Bir akım algılama ünitesi
  • ADC
  • Bir voltaj algılama ünitesi
  • Adafruit.IO
  • Ahududu Pi

Akım ve voltaj algılama birimleri, sisteminize gerekli girişi sağlayacaktır. Raspberry Pi ile çalışabilen herhangi bir akım sensörünü kullanabilirsiniz. Voltaj algılama birimi ve mevcut algılama birimleri giriş bölümünü, ADC ve Raspberry Pi ise işlem birimini oluşturur. Bulgularımızı (çıktı) saklamak için Adafruit.IO kullanıyoruz. Tüm bu bilgileri buluta kaydeder. Böylece bu verilere dünyanın her yerinden istediğiniz zaman erişebilirsiniz.

3. Raspberry Pi ile bir Wi-Fi Menzil Genişletici Oluşturun

Wi-Fi yönlendiricileri veya cihazları kullanırken herkes 'sınırlı menzil' sorunuyla karşı karşıyadır. Wi-Fi yönlendiriciler mutlaka büyük bir yarıçapı kapsamaz ve bu aralığın dışına çıkarsanız bağlantı sorunlarıyla karşılaşmaya başlar ve sonunda bağlantıyı tamamen kaybedersiniz.

Bir Wi-Fi genişletici kullanarak Wi-Fi cihazınızın kapsama alanını genişletebilirsiniz. Bu projede, bunlardan birini inşa edeceksiniz.

Elektronik iletişim meraklıları için en iyi Raspberry Pi IoT projelerinden biridir. Bir Nesnelerin İnterneti projesi olduğu için genişleticiyi uzaktan kullanabilecek ve otomatikleştirebileceksiniz. Bu proje üzerinde çalışmak için Nodemcu ESP8266'ya ihtiyacınız olacak. Arduino'nun özelliklerine ve aynı zamanda bir Wi-Fi modülüne sahip bir IoT geliştirme platformudur. Arduino IDE'yi bir USB arayüzü ile bağlayarak kullanabilir ve buna göre programlayabilirsiniz.

ESP8266 özelliğini kullanmak için Flash İndirme aracını web sitesinden indirmeniz gerekir. ESP8266'nızı yapılandırmanıza izin verir. Bu projeyi tamamladıktan sonra, birçok IoT ve elektronik iletişim kavramına aşina olacaksınız. Başlangıç ​​seviyesindeki projeler arasında yer alıyor bu yüzden daha önce bir IoT çözümü üzerinde çalışmadıysanız ve buradan başlamalısınız.

Okuyun: Hindistan'da IoT Mühendisi / Geliştirici Maaşı

4. IoT Tabanlı Bir Tarım Çözümü Yaratın

Evlerde ve ofislerde teknolojinin uygulamalarını duyuyoruz, ancak bu projede bir bahçe (veya bir çiftlik) için bir çözüm oluşturacaksınız. Burada Raspberry Pi'yi tarımsal bir çözüm oluşturmak için kullanacağız. Topraktaki nem seviyesini izler ve otomatik olarak sulardı. Yani, bir bahçeye sahipseniz (boyutu ne olursa olsun), özellikle bu projeyi seveceksiniz. Bahçenizi korumanıza ve bir çok zorluğu gidermenize yardımcı olur.

Bir röle modülüne, bir Arduino'ya, bir toprak nemi sensörüne, bir çift boruya ve bir hortuma, bir Bluetooth Hc 5'e, bir solenoid valfe ve kablolara ihtiyacınız olacak. Bu proje, IoT'yi gerçek hayatta nasıl kullanabileceğinizi öğrenmenin ve sıradan görevleri otomatikleştirmenin harika bir yoludur. Küçük bir saksı bitkisi ile başlayabilir ve sistemi başarıyla uyguladıktan sonra daha büyük bir bahçeye veya bir grup saksı bitkisine geçebilirsiniz.

5. Raspberry Pi ile Yüz Tanıma Robotu Geliştirin

Yüz tanıma, bir bilgisayarın özelliklerini analiz ederek bir yüzü tanıdığı AI tabanlı bir teknolojidir. Yüz tanıma, modern cihazlarda yaygınlaştı ve uygulamasını akıllı telefonlar ve sosyal medya gibi birçok yerde görmüş olmalısınız. Bu konsepte aşinaysanız ve bunu bir robotta uygulamak istiyorsanız, bunu Raspberry Pi ile yapabilirsiniz.

Biraz ekstra çaba gerektiren Raspberry Pi IoT projeleri arasında yer alıyor. Ancak, işiniz bittiğinde, sonuç buna değecektir. Ayrıca, bu proje üzerinde çalışmaya başlamadan önce Arduino, Raspberry Pi kameralar ve robotik hakkında bilgi sahibi olmalısınız.

Bir amplifikatöre, USB veri kablosuna, bir güç adaptörüne, servo motorlara ve bir robot kafasına ihtiyacınız olacaktır (INMOOVE'u kullanabilirsiniz). Ayrıca bu projeyi verimli bir şekilde tamamlayabilmeniz için bir Raspberry Pi kartı programlamaya da aşina olmalısınız. Bu projeyi tamamlamak için aşağıdaki Python kitaplıklarına ihtiyacınız olacak:

  • Matplot
  • CV2
  • OpenCV
  • Dizi
  • Keras
  • Yüz tanıma
  • scipy
  • konuşmak

Daha önce bir robot yapmadıysanız, temel bilgilerle başlamanızı ve robotunuza yalnızca yüz tanıma işlevini eklemenizi öneririz. Öte yandan, bu projeyi biraz daha zorlu hale getirmek istiyorsanız, robotun tanıdığı yüzün adını söyleyeceği yerde konuşma işlevselliğini ekleyebilirsiniz. Biraz ekstra çaba gerektirebilir, ancak bundan sonra robotunuz tamamen işlevsel olacaktır.

Öğrenin: Yüz Tanımada MATLAB Uygulaması: Kod, Açıklama ve Sözdizimi

6. Raspberry Pi ile Nesnelerin İnterneti Tabanlı Akıllı Ev Sistemi Oluşturun

Akıllı Evlere aşina mısınız? Akıllı bir evde, cihazların çoğu otomatiktir ve bunları uzaktan kontrol edebilirsiniz. Nesnelerin İnterneti'nin en popüler uygulamaları arasındadırlar. Raspberry Pi ve Bluetooth ile evinizi akıllı ev haline getirebilirsiniz. Raspberry Pi zaten bir Bluetooth modülüne sahip olduğundan, onu yalnızca bir cihaza (veya birden fazla cihaza) bağlamanız ve ardından mobil cihazınızla o cihazı kontrol edebilmeniz için cep telefonunuzla yapılandırmanız gerekir.

Cihaza bağlayıp yapılandırdıktan sonra, gerekli araca istediğiniz zaman istediğiniz yerden erişebilmeniz için onu buluta katabilirsiniz.

Tek bir cihazla başlayabilir ve bunu başarıyla uyguladıktan sonra, uzaktan erişebileceğiniz daha kapsamlı bir araç ağı oluşturmaya geçebilirsiniz. Bu proje üzerinde çalışmak, IoT'nin çeşitli gerçek yaşam uygulamalarını keşfetmenize yardımcı olacaktır.

Son düşünceler

Raspberry Pi IoT projeleri listemizi beğeneceğinizi umuyoruz.

Makine öğrenimi ve yapay zekada ustalaşmayı merak ediyorsanız, IIIT-B ve Liverpool John Moores Üniversitesi ile Makine Öğrenimi ve Yapay Zeka alanında Yüksek Lisansımızla kariyerinizi artırın.

Raspberry Pi IoT için İyi mi?

IoT cihazlarının, ana CPU olarak bir mikro denetleyiciye ve ağ arabirimi olarak bir Wi-Fi modülüne sahip düşük güçlü SoC cihazları olması gerekmez. Örneğin, standart bir PC bir IoT cihazı olarak kullanılabilir, ancak PC'lerin yüzlerce watt şebeke elektriği gerektirmesi nedeniyle bunu yapmak zor olacaktır. Raspberry Pi ise birçok IoT cihazından önemli ölçüde daha güçlü ve IoT işleme için mükemmel bir seçenek olan bir bilgisayardır. Raspberry Pi bilgisayarları olağanüstü küçüktür, bir kredi kartından biraz daha büyüktür ve çok az güç tüketir. Bazı Pi bilgisayarlar, onlara yeterli işlem gücü sağlayan 64 bit dört çekirdekli bir işlemci içerir. Ayrıca 1 GB'a kadar RAM, yerleşik Wi-Fi ve ek elektroniklere bağlanmak için bol miktarda GPIO sunarlar.

Raspberry Pi ile IoT nedir?

Nesnelerin interneti (IoT), özellikle Apple'ın AirTag'leri piyasaya çıktığından beri son yıllarda büyük bir konu haline geldi. Nesnelerin interneti (IoT), çeşitli cihazları veri paylaşabilen veri toplama teknolojisine (sensörler gibi) bağlayan bir ağdır. Nesnelerin İnterneti'nin amacı, size, kullanıcıya mümkün olan en büyük deneyimi sağlamak için bireysel cihazların iletişim kurmasına ve işbirliği yapmasına izin vermektir. Küçük boyutları ve kapsamlı yetenekleri nedeniyle, Raspberry Pi kartları, DIY IoT cihazlarına iyi uyarlanmış, son derece popüler tek kartlı bilgisayarlardır. Raspberry Pi kartları, her biri kendi konektör ve sensör setine sahip çeşitli boyut ve konfigürasyonlarda gelir.

IoT'de sensör nedir?

Sensörler, IoT çözümlerinin geliştirilmesinde çok önemlidir. Sensörler, harici verileri algılayan ve insanların ve robotların anlayabileceği bir sinyalle değiştiren cihazlardır. Sensörler hemen hemen her durumda veri toplamayı mümkün kılmıştır ve şu anda tıbbi tedavi, huzurevinde bakım, üretim, lojistik, ulaşım, tarım, afetten korunma, turizm, bölgesel işletmeler ve daha pek çok sektörde kullanılmaktadır. daha fazla.